public ActionResult VehicleInfoManager(int page = 1, int pageSize = 10) { List <VehicleinfoViewModel> f = lk.GetAll(); Session["VehicleInfoAll"] = f; List <BrandViewModel> s = br.GetAll(); Session["brandAll"] = s; List <ModelViewModel> o = md.GetAll(); Session["modelAll"] = o; List <VehicleinfoViewModel> Listvh = new List <VehicleinfoViewModel>(); PagedList <VehicleinfoViewModel> PageListVH; if (Session["VHSearch"] != null) { Listvh = (List <VehicleinfoViewModel>)Session["VHSearch"]; PageListVH = new PagedList <VehicleinfoViewModel>(Listvh, page, pageSize); } else { Listvh = lk.GetAll(); PageListVH = new PagedList <VehicleinfoViewModel>(Listvh, page, pageSize); } return(View(PageListVH)); }
public ActionResult ModelManager(int page = 1, int pageSize = 10) { List <ModelViewModel> s = saf.GetAll(); Session["ListAllModel"] = s; List <BrandViewModel> a = brd.GetAll(); Session["LisBrandAll"] = a; List <ModelViewModel> ListModel = new List <ModelViewModel>(); PagedList <ModelViewModel> PagedListModel; if (Session["SearchModel"] != null) { ListModel = (List <ModelViewModel>)Session["SearchModel"]; PagedListModel = new PagedList <ModelViewModel>(ListModel, page, pageSize); } else { ListModel = saf.GetAll(); PagedListModel = new PagedList <ModelViewModel>(ListModel, page, pageSize); } return(View(PagedListModel)); }